Emergency Nurse Pediatric Course

ENPC Provider

The Emergency Nurse Pediatric Course (ENPC) is a two-day course designed to orient nurses to the special needs of pediatric care in the emergency department setting. Students who complete the course receive a certificate valid for four years that can be renewed in a one-day Reverification Course run concurrently with the second day of a Provider Course. The course material is similar to Pediatric Advanced Life Support (PALS) offered by the American Heart Association, but not identical.

ENPC covers a broader array of topics pertinent to the practicing emergency nurse.

ENPC Instructor

In order to become an ENPC instructor, this procedure must be followed:

a. The Course Director of an ENPC Course that you have taken must recommend you as a potential instructor.

b. You must meet the following criteria to be recommended:

  • Achievement of at least 90% on multiple choice exam
  • Achievement of at least 85% of total points in all skill stations except triage
  • Recommendation of course Director and instructors (letter would be sent to you after the course)

c. If you have met these criteria, the following must be submitted to the State Pediatric Chairperson for review:

  • Letter of recommendation from Course Director
  • A curriculum vitae (maximum two pages) with two years experience caring for pediatric or trauma patients
  • Letter expressing commitment and interest in teaching future ENPC

When there are sufficient instructor candidates, a course will be planned to accommodate them.
